(Patriot, Ind.) - A reward is being offered for the arrest and conviction of the person or persons responsible for shooting the windows out of some construction equipment in Switzerland County.
According to the Switzerland County Sheriff’s Office, the vandalism took just a couple miles out of Patriot on State Road 156 headed towards Vevay on January 3 between 7:30 and 8:00 p.m.
A witness saw a maroon, faded, rusty colored full sized truck with a loud muffler driving with their headlights out past the equipment around the same time as the vandalism.
Anyone with information about the incident should contact the Switzerland County Sheriff at 812-427-3636.
A $1,500 reward is being offered for information that leads to an arrest and conviction.
